Examples of allowed bags include clear plastic bags, small clutch bags, and bags with a single compartment. There are also specific size restrictions that bags must adhere to, ensuring that all fans have an unobstructed view of the stage. Additionally, certain styles of bags, such as backpacks and large purses, are prohibited for security reasons.
